What Defines a Crypto Games Casino?
A crypto video games casino is an online betting platform that integrates blockchain technology to help with deposits, withdrawals, and, in many cases, the real video game logic. Unlike traditional online casinos, which count on centralized banking systems and fiat currency (GBP, EUR, GBP), crypto casinos use decentralized journals to process transactions.
Much of these platforms are "crypto-native," suggesting they were developed from the ground up to support blockchain possessions. Others are "hybrid" websites, providing both conventional credit card processing and cryptocurrency choices.
Key Characteristics of Crypto Casinos:
- Decentralized Nature: Reduced reliance on standard banking intermediaries.
- Smart Contracts: Used in "Provably Fair" video games to make sure outcomes are not controlled by the casino.
- Anonymity: Many platforms permit account registration without substantial KYC (Know Your Customer) documents.
- Deal Speed: Deposits are normally near-instant, and withdrawals are processed in minutes rather than days.

Provably Fair Gaming: The Gold Standard
Among the most considerable contributions of blockchain technology to the gaming industry is the concept of "Provably Fair" video gaming. In a traditional online casino, gamers need to trust the operator's assertion that their random number generator (RNG) is objective.
In a crypto casino, the video game reasoning is often recorded on the blockchain. This allows players to confirm, using cryptographic hashes, that the outcome of a video game-- whether it is a slot spin, a hand of blackjack, or a roll of the dice-- was figured out before the bet was positioned and might not have been modified by the casino. This levels the playing field, moving the trust from the casino's reputation to mathematical certainty.

Popular Game Categories in Crypto Casinos
Crypto gambling establishments have actually diversified significantly. While traditional slots remain popular, new formats have actually gotten traction:
- Crash Games: A high-speed video game where a multiplier increases quickly, and gamers need to "cash out" before the video game crashes. This is a staple of crypto-native platforms.
- Dice Games: Simplified, high-speed wagering where gamers anticipate whether a roll will be over or under a specific number.
- Live Dealer Tables: High-definition streaming of real-world blackjack, live roulette, and baccarat, now playable with crypto chips.
- Blockchain-Powered Slots: Slots that feature integrated prize pools funded by clever contracts.
